In keeping with traditions of Old Testament times, Mary took Jesus to the temple to be "presented" 40 days after his birth. There, in the temple, was the priest Simeon, who had always prayed to live long enough to see the Savior promised by the Lord.
When he saw the baby Jesus, Simeon knew he had seen the Savior who would bring the light of the Lord to the world.
As you color this picture that show's Mary presenting the baby Jesus to Simeon, think about what this ceremony reveals about Jesus' parents. It shows they were pious and dedicated.
Why is it so important to know that Simeon immediately knew he was in God's presence? That was God revealing the Savior to him, and further confirmation of Jesus' true purpose.
